microphones
Pronunciation: [ˈmaɪkrəˌfoʊnz]
Word
Context: “audio recording”
(noun) a device used to capture sound, such as a voice or music. When someone speaks into a microphone, it picks up their voice and makes it louder or saves it for later.
Example
The singer used a microphone to make her voice heard in the big stadium.
Example
Without a microphone, the teacher couldn't be heard at the back of the large classroom.
Example
Can you hand me that microphone so I can speak on stage?
Context: “technology”
(noun) a tool that turns sound into an electrical signal. It helps people communicate or record sounds in movies, music, and talks.
Example
They used special microphones to record all the sounds for the movie.
Example
The recording failed because the microphones weren't plugged in properly.
Example
What type of microphones are best for live performances?
